Shipping Timeframes: Flexible Options Available

Transit times from Yiwu to Malaysia primarily depend on the selected shipping method. Two main options exist:

  • LCL (Less than Container Load): Ideal for smaller shipments, this method consolidates multiple shippers' goods into a single container. While economical, the waiting period for container consolidation extends delivery times to approximately 30-45 days.
  • FCL (Full Container Load): Suitable for larger shipments filling an entire container, this dedicated service offers faster transit times of 20-25 days. Actual durations may vary based on carrier schedules and shipping routes.

Shipping Process: Critical Steps Explained

The maritime shipping process involves multiple stages requiring careful attention:

  1. Customs Declaration and Inspection: All export goods must undergo proper customs clearance, with certain product categories requiring additional inspection certificates.
  2. Booking and Container Loading: After securing shipping space with a carrier, goods must be properly packed into containers with accurate documentation. Proper cargo arrangement prevents damage during transit.
  3. Ocean Transport: Shippers can track container movement using bill of lading numbers during the voyage.
  4. Port Clearance: Upon arrival in Malaysia, importers must complete customs clearance procedures, including duty payments, before taking possession of goods.

Economic Advantages of Sea Freight

Maritime shipping offers significant cost savings compared to air freight, particularly for bulk shipments without urgent delivery requirements. Modern container shipping also provides reliable security when goods are properly packaged. The LCL option further reduces costs for smaller shipments through shared container space.
